Angel Ace Is Breaking Borders
Dec 7th
One of Spain’s most prolific dance music producer is Angel Acebrón Torres. You may know him through his aliases Serenade, Micheal Delving or Angel Ace. He got our attention with his track this year called “Everything’s Gonna Be Fine.” Angel was voted Spanish Trance producer of 2005 and 2006 consecutively by DJ One Magazine. His colourful discography since 2003 consists of a string of quality productions and remixes that infuse new age and uplifting trance.
This is his exclusive interview with Radio KUL Extra.

Angel Ace
Hi Angel. Thanks for doing the interview. How are you today?
Hello guys! Fine thanks! I’m very proud to be part of your project with my guestmix and this interview.
Tell us about Only One Records.
Only One is my personal dream and it’s turning into a reality bit by bit. Many producers have taken an interest in my project, which has been supported by many top DJs around the world (Armin van Buuren, Tiesto, Above and Beyond, Aly and Fila, DJ Shah, and many others). Since the beginning, we’ve received very good tracks and I think the quality of the label is rising. We are establishing ourselves into the important online stores.
You have quite a lot of experience in radio. Do you have a particular interest in radio shows and where can we listen to your show?
Yeah! I love radio shows. I have 3 monthly shows and many guestmixes. You can listen to me on the second Tuesday of every month on Afterhours.FM, and on the fourth Wednesday of every month on ETN.FM.
What has been your favourite record of 2009?
It’s a difficult choice. In my opinion 2009 has a been a great year for tunes but my favourite is Andy Blueman’s “Neverland.”
2009 has been a great year for you, especially with your hit “Everything’s Gonna Be Fine” that we love so much. What’s in store for 2010?
I have finished several tunes and remixes for 2010 but I’m not sure when it will be released. I have a new tune as Angel Ace called “St. Thomas” which I hope will be released with great remixes, and I have a new track as my alias Micheal Delving, a new Serenade and remixes for Simon Pitt, Redsound and more surprises in store.
What influences are apparent in your productions and remixes?
I’m always looking for a great melody that can be remembered, so my productions are always influenced by magical soundtracks and new age producers.
What is the trance scene like in Spain?
The Spanish trance scene is not yet where it can be. There isn’t enough support and there are only a few producers and DJs are who are trying to spread this style of music. There are some events in Barcelona, Madrid, and Navarra, etc. These are great parties but still with a limited audience.
What advice would you give aspiring dance music producers?
They must believe in their dream and they must have illusion, these things are indispensable for being a great artiste.
Is there an artiste, DJ or producer that you would like to collaborate with?
Many! But I choose Ferry Corsten, Mike Oldfield, Vangelies, or Hans Zimmer. This would be great!
Can you tell us 3 artistes that have been influential and inspiring to you.
Ferry Corsten, Vangelis, and Aly and Fila amongst many others.
What has been your favourite Angel Ace production or remix and why?
Without a doubt “776 Miles.” It was a special tune for me and it was supported by one of my idols, Ferry Corsten.
What’s currently playing on your iPod?
Trance music from well known producers and some new talent too, and also one demo and some new age music.
And lastly, a quick message to all your fans reading this!
Many thanks for all your support and your believe in this dream that we share. I hope to see you soon and thanks for your interest in my music!
